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$2,083 per month in Malmo vs $1,793 in Norrkoping, rent included.

A couple spends around $3,221 per month in Malmo vs $2,682 in Norrkoping, rent included.

A family of three spends $4,359 per month in Malmo vs $3,571 in Norrkoping, rent included.

Malmo costs about 16% more than Norrkoping,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both Malmo and Norrkoping sit above the global median – Malmo by 52%, Norrkoping by 31%.
